> > Got some HTML to show of the <select> box?
>
> > if you have
>
> > <select id="right" mulitple="multiple">
> >      <option value="1">One</option>
> >      <option value="2" selected="selected">Two</option>
> >      <option value="3" selected="selected">Three</option>
> > </select>
>
> > then
>
> > $("#right").val()  will be an array that is "2,3"
>
> > if it's not like that, then (1) your selector doesn't work, (2)
> > there's nothing actually selected
